The Opportunity
We are seeking an experienced and dynamic Groups & Events (Reactive) Sales Executive Job Ad to be part of the creation of an extraordinary sales experience at The St. Regis London. This individual must have a proven track record in luxury sales and converting group and event business leads on the 5 star London market.
Key Responsibilities
· Sales Strategy & Revenue Generation: Work with Proactive Sales to execute sales plans for group/event segments (corporate, social) to meet and exceed revenue goals.
· Client Acquisition & Management: Identify, prospect, and convert new business, build strong client relationships (planners, agencies), and manage key accounts for repeat business.
· Proposals & Site Inspections: Create compelling customized proposals, lead venue tours, and present confidently to potential clients.
· Market Awareness: Conduct market research, stay updated on industry trends, and analyse competitor activity.
· Internal Collaboration: Work closely with Groups/MICE proactive sales and Director of Revenue colleagues as well as Operations, Catering, Front Office teams as well for seamless group and event delivery and accurate forecasting.
· Administration: Manage CRM, diary, contracts, sales reports, and ensure accurate event details are communicated internally.
What We’re Looking For
You should have:
· Strong negotiation, strategic planning, and sales skills.
· Excellent communication, interpersonal, and presentation abilities.
· Highly organized, proactive, adaptable, and detail-oriented.
· Proven track record in hospitality group and events sales.
· A love of fostering close knit client relationships
